ERP对接项目

huangc 87b62f95ef audit erpbx 7 년 전
hooks 0f80faa4c0 init erp_h5 7 년 전
platforms 0f80faa4c0 init erp_h5 7 년 전
plugins 0f80faa4c0 init erp_h5 7 년 전
resources 0f80faa4c0 init erp_h5 7 년 전
scss 87b62f95ef audit erpbx 7 년 전
www 87b62f95ef audit erpbx 7 년 전
.bowerrc 0f80faa4c0 init erp_h5 7 년 전
.gitignore 0f80faa4c0 init erp_h5 7 년 전
README.md 0f80faa4c0 init erp_h5 7 년 전
_anywhere.bat 0f80faa4c0 init erp_h5 7 년 전
_runandroid.bat 0f80faa4c0 init erp_h5 7 년 전
bower.json 0f80faa4c0 init erp_h5 7 년 전
color.png 0f80faa4c0 init erp_h5 7 년 전
config.xml 0f80faa4c0 init erp_h5 7 년 전
docker.md 0f80faa4c0 init erp_h5 7 년 전
gulpfile.js 0f80faa4c0 init erp_h5 7 년 전
ionic.config.json 0f80faa4c0 init erp_h5 7 년 전
ionic.md 0f80faa4c0 init erp_h5 7 년 전
ionic.project 0f80faa4c0 init erp_h5 7 년 전
package.json 0f80faa4c0 init erp_h5 7 년 전
runandroid.sh 0f80faa4c0 init erp_h5 7 년 전

README.md

h5

先安装node.js

安装成功后,现在命令行进行安装ionic和cordova

mac下需加sudo权限

1、安装npm镜像
npm install -g cnpm

cnpm install -g ionic@1.7.16
cnpm install -g cordova

安装完成后进入到项目所在文件夹,进行npm,bower,sass的更新和安装
1、安装gulp自动化构建工具
cnpm install gulp //windows 加 -g

2、安装bower前端包管理工具
cnpm install bower //windows 加 -g

3、安装npm插件
cnpm install

4、安装bower插件
bower install   //mac 加 --allow-root

5、安装sass插件
ionic setup sass

Debug 在chrome进行调试

chrome://inspect/#devices
手机进入某一个应用模块,再chrome进入webview页面即可

Android/IOS打包 apk

添加resources

ionic resources

添加相对应的平台

ionic platform add anroid/ios

Android需安装JDK

配置环境变量JAVA_HOME
准备SDK
添加 CORDOVA_ANDROID_GRADLE_DISTRIBUTION_URL file:///D:/android-sdk/gradle-2.13-all.zip

前端资源打包

ionic prepare android/ios

初始化

安装cnpm

npm install -g cnpm --registry=https://registry.npm.taobao.org

安装依赖

* bower install
* cnpm install

运行

ionic run android --device s -cls

webstorm破解

http://idea.iteblog.com/key.php

资料

ionic 中文官方文档

http://www.ionic-china.com/
在网页的右上角 --> 中文文档

ionic 例子

http://codepen.io/ionic/pens/public/

underscore

http://www.css88.com/doc/underscore/